    Hi everyone,
    I've finally finished my Confederate officer bust.
    It's resin, 1/10th scale and made by Bonapartes.
    For those of you not familiar with long the story behind it, I replaced the hat in his left hand with a scratch built spyglass. I had to do this because when I was cleaning it up, the brim snapped and I wasn't able to fix it well enough to still use it.
    To all of those that took the time to offer comments to me, thank you for your help. I used your suggestions where I thought I could without too much difficulty. This one took long enough without risking screwing it up any more than I already have :p .
    I'd appreciate any thought you have on how it turned out.

    Hola Craig!

    Great work on your bust! Regarding the eyes, the key to eyes are to paint the iris color lighter so that you can paint the black pupil. I would also suggest adding a catchlight in each eye, really brings them alive!
